Specifications:
1. Primary Technical Data
1)Chemical composition
Alloy | Si | Fe | Cu | Mn | Mg | Cr | Zn | Ti | Impurity | Al |
6063 | 0.2-0.6 | 0.35 | 0.1 | 0.1 | 0.45-0.9 | 0.1 | 0.1 | 0.1 | 0.15 | Rest |
6061 | 0.4-0.8 | 0.7 | 0.15-0.4 | 0.15 | 0.8-1.2 | 0.04-0.35 | 0.25 | 0.15 | 0.15 | Rest |
6060 | 0.3-0.6 | 0.1-0.3 | 0.1 | 0.1 | 0.35-0.6 | - | 0.15 | 0.1 | 0.15 | Rest |
6005 | 0.6-0.9 | 0.35 | 0.1 | 0.1 | 0.40-0.6 | 0.1 | 0.1 | 0.1 | 0.15 | Rest |
2) Mechanical property
Alloy | Temper | Tensile strength | Yield strength | Elongation |
6063 | T5 | ≥ 160Mpa | ≥ 110Mpa | ≥ 8% |
T6 | ≥ 205Mpa | ≥ 180Mpa | ≥ 8% | |
6061 | T6 | ≥ 265Mpa | ≥ 245Mpa | ≥ 8% |
